Sochaux earn home point against Bastia

Emmanuel Mayuka's second-half strike sees Sochaux come back to earn a point at home to Bastia.

Sochaux have held Bastia to a 1-1 draw at Stade Auguste Bonal to deny them the chance to go sixth in Ligue 1.

Bastia's Franco Algerian midfielder Ryad Boudebouz scores a goal past Sochaux goalkeeper Simon Pouplin on November 23, 2013© Getty Images

Ryad Boudebouz gave the visitors the lead just after the half-hour mark, although goalkeeper Mickael Landreau had to be alert to keep out Rafael Dias just before the break.

Les Lionceaux's equaliser came in the 74th minute through Emmanuel Mayuka, who latched onto Petrus Boumal's cross to shoot left footed past the veteran keeper.

A point means that the hosts remain bottom, but are now level on points with Ajaccio. Meanwhile, the Corsican team stay ninth.
